What Antioxidants Do for the Skin

Antioxidants are substances that help neutralise unstable molecules known as free radicals. Free radicals are produced when the skin is exposed to environmental stress such as ultraviolet radiation or pollution. These unstable molecules can affect the skin’s natural proteins, including collagen and elastin, which contribute to the skin’s structure and resilience.

By helping neutralise free radicals, antioxidants support the skin’s natural protective systems. This allows the skin to maintain balance while reducing the impact of environmental stress over time. While antioxidants do not stop natural ageing processes, they can help support the skin’s ability to maintain healthy structure and function.

Why Antioxidants Are Often Used in Morning Skincare

Antioxidant products are frequently incorporated into morning skincare routines because they help protect the skin throughout the day. Environmental exposure tends to occur during daylight hours, particularly through ultraviolet radiation and environmental pollutants. Using antioxidants during the day helps support the skin’s defence mechanisms while maintaining overall skin balance.

Antioxidants are often used alongside daily sun protection to help support the skin’s protective barrier. Together, these measures help reduce the impact of environmental stress on the skin.
